If you have a manual action against your site for unnatural links to your site, or if you think you're about to get such a manual action (because of paid links or other link schemes that violate our quality guidelines), you should try to remove the links from the other site to your site. If you can't remove those links yourself, or get them removed, then you should disavow the URLs of the questionable pages or domains that link to your website. This is an advanced feature and should only be used with caution. If used incorrectly, this feature can potentially harm your site’s performance in Google Search results. Step 0: Decide if this is necessaryIn most cases, Google can assess which links to trust without additional guidance, so most sites will not need to use this tool. The disavow links tool does not support Domain properties. If you have a Domain property, this page does not apply to you. Step 1: Create a list of links to disavowAssemble your list of pages or domains to disavow in a text file that you will upload to Google. Link file format:
Example: # Two pages to disavow http://spam.example.com/stuff/comments.html http://spam.example.com/stuff/paid-links.html # One domain to disavow domain:shadyseo.com If you have found URLs or sites to disavow in the links report for your site, you can download the data from the Links report by clicking the export button. Be sure to remove any URLs from the downloaded file that you don't want to disavow. Step 2: Upload your list

To view this video please enable JavaScript, and consider upgrading to a web browser that supports HTML5 video What Is a Google Backlink?A Google backlink is a backlink from a Google-owned website property. Google backlinks are inbound links to a website or some other web resource from properties like Google Sites, My Business Profile, Google News, YouTube, Docs, and Sheets that are crawled and indexed in the search engine results pages. Backlinks from a Google property are considered to be beneficial for SEO because these websites have naturally high PageRank authority. High PR backlinks can help your site rank higher in the SERPS because some of the PageRank value is transferred to your domain (or individual web page) through the link which Google’s algorithm takes into consideration during the indexing and ranking process. 4. Get Links From Google CloudThe Google Cloud Platform lets you build and deploy websites and applications using the same infrastructure as Google. And, you can harness the power of this platform to build backlinks to your website and other important web resources. After joining Google Cloud, you just need to create a new project, then create a new bucket. Inside the buck, you can upload HTML files that include backlinks to any website property you want. However, these links won’t be crawled or indexed unless you follow one additional step. Edit the bucket permissions, then click “Add Member”. Next, type in “allusers” into the search bar, and select the allusers option. This opens up the bucket so it can be accessed by the public for crawling and indexing purposes. 5. 9. Add Your Location to Google My MapsGoogle My Maps is a feature in Google Maps that allows users to create custom maps for personal use or to share with others. It’s also a good place to add a location for your business that includes your name, address, phone number, and website link. To use Google My Maps for backlinks, you need to create a new My Map, then set up a new point on that map. Next, in the point description field, you can add your website’s URL which automatically gets turned into a hyperlink after you save the changes. Some link building agencies suggest adding a target keyword and the brand name into the point title field to help improve the SEO relevancy of the backlink in the description area. 10. Final Tip for Creating Backlinks From GoogleOne final word of caution before you go and build a large number of Google backlinks at scale. As mentioned in Google’s link schemes documentation, “Any links intended to manipulate PageRank or a site’s ranking in Google search results may be considered part of a link scheme and a violation of Google’s Webmaster Guidelines. This includes any behavior that manipulates links to your site or outgoing links from your site.” Keep that in mind as you’re creating incoming links to your website from Google-owned properties. Don’t just add low-quality links to each of these platforms with the sole purpose of improving your website’s SEO rankings. Google’s algorithm can ignore or devalue links from any website, application, or online platform. So you want to do everything you can to make sure the content you’re creating on Google that has backlinks to your website is high-quality and warrants a natural backlink for inclusion. A better link building strategy that’s safer from a potential algorithm penalty is to pick and choose a few Google properties that make the most sense for your business, brand, and website. Then create the best content possible on those platforms that benefit the user while also adding your site’s backlink. A high-quality Google Site, for example, that includes a lot of important information about your business and its brand, while also linking back to your website and other Google properties you’ve created (e.g., Docs, Sheets, Forms, YouTube, etc), is a perfectly legitimate way of using Google’s own properties for backlinks. (This technique is the basic framework of Google Stacking which is an SEO method of stacking Google entities on top of each other to give every link more PageRank authority.) A good rule of thumb before building any backlink is to ask yourself this question, “If a user came across this Google backlink asset, would it harm my brand?” If the answer is yes, then you should improve the content or remove the link. If the answer is no, then the hyperlink can be beneficial for your brand and the website’s off-page search engine optimization.
